Hi
Ich bin jetzt bei der Vererbung angekommen und hab noch meine kleinen Probleme:
1. (hängt vermutlich auch irgendwie mit Vererbung zusammen..):
Was bringt es eine Klasse public zu machen? (mal angenommen ich habe 3 Klassen, alle im selben File). Was bringt es? Nichts oder? Denn Methoden kann man ja in einer nur mit class {} definierten Klasse public machen und das sollte doch schon reichen oder?
2. Wenn ich einen Konstruktor in einer Superklasse definiere, kann ich dann einen anderen Konstruktor in der Subklasse verwenden? Das klappt soweit ich das sehe nicht..?!
Bitte helft mir
Ich bin jetzt bei der Vererbung angekommen und hab noch meine kleinen Probleme:
1. (hängt vermutlich auch irgendwie mit Vererbung zusammen..):
Was bringt es eine Klasse public zu machen? (mal angenommen ich habe 3 Klassen, alle im selben File). Was bringt es? Nichts oder? Denn Methoden kann man ja in einer nur mit class {} definierten Klasse public machen und das sollte doch schon reichen oder?
2. Wenn ich einen Konstruktor in einer Superklasse definiere, kann ich dann einen anderen Konstruktor in der Subklasse verwenden? Das klappt soweit ich das sehe nicht..?!
Bitte helft mir